Salicornia straw residue is a rich source of bioactive polyphenols, including hydroxybenzoic, hydroxycinnamic, and caffeoylquinic acids, and flavonoids, with antioxidant capacity reaching 4.5–4.6 g GAE/kg via sub-critical water or Soxhlet extraction—surpassing blueberry. The study, part of the AQUACOMBINE project, evaluates phenolic extraction from Salicornia ramosissima (glasswort) for applications in functional food, feed, and pharmaceuticals. Analytical methods include DPPH and Folin-Ciocalteu assays, confirming 15 identified antioxidants. Extraction efficiency and compound stability are critical for digestibility and bioavailability. Salt-decontaminated straw enhances antioxidant delivery in formulations.
